Before you start the treadmill, firmly grasp the back of the deck, and lift it until it's parallel to the frame. When lifting, make sure to straighten your back and keep your shoulders away from your ears. Be careful not to fall on the deck, which could hurt you or damage the frame or your floor. Pull the latch knob or pin that keeps the deck once it's in the correct position. Slowly lower the frame until its fully unfolded position.

The world's most compact treadmill is equipped with cutting-edge technology and even more features that are space-saving. The patented folding mechanism packs a full treadmill into less than 0.5m2 It's as easy as folding it and plug it in! The treadmill's Mirage LED display as well as the Dynamax app show live workout feedback, and an eco-efficient motor of 1 HP delivers speed of up to 9 kph. The 120 x 44cm running surface is cushioned by an ultra-low-impact, soft gel-lined deck. The frame made of aluminum can support a maximum weight of 110kg.

You should also look into the treadmill's Folding treadmill cheap and unfolding mechanism to see whether it's simple to use. Many foldable treadmills have gas-shocks that help them fold up treadmill in a safe manner and gradually lower to the floor after folding. If you do not have this feature, the treadmill could fall to the ground when you let it go. This could damage your furniture or floors.

Certain models come with locks that must be activated to fold the deck. You should ensure whether the lock is locked before cleaning, moving or storing your machine.

Some treadmills fold with a gas shock that lowers the deck slowly and gently to the ground when released. This is a major advantage if you have pets or children in the house. This feature can help you save time and money since you won't have to pay for repairs if your deck is damaged.
